Local program brings educational orchards to schools

DURHAM — ReTreeUS, a Maine-based project of the nonprofit United Charitable Programs, installed four educational fruit tree orchards this year, and has planted eight total educational orchards since 2012. “The orchards are provided at no cost to schools,” says co-founder Moriah Salter, “and they come with innumerable benefits both for the earth and for participants.” […]

Freeport High School bond defeated

DURHAM — Voters in the RSU 5 towns of Durham, Freeport and Pownal narrowly defeated a proposal to bond up to $16.95 million for improvements to Freeport High School. The vote was 2,028 to 2,202. Lisbon driver hurt in car crash

DURHAM — A Lisbon driver was injured Tuesday night when he lost control of his car on Pinkham Brook Road and it rolled over, state police said.
